Berisha launches campaign at Kamza

18/04/2011 19:20

Prime Minister Sali Berisha launched the electoral campaign in Kamza, presenting the Democratic Party candidate, Xhelal Mziu.

During his speech, Berisha valued the work of the Kamza residents, who, according to him, turned this commune into a modern city.

“In these 20 years you have built with your sweat and hard work the most beautiful dream of man. You turned Kamza into one of the most modern cities”, Berisha declared.

Inviting the residents to vote the candidate Mziu on May 8th, Berisha promised massive investments in the Kamza infrastructure.

“We will turn the Kamza of these men and women into one of most urbanized cities in Albania. We have paved 60 km of main roads in this city, and in the next four years we will pave every road and alley, and Kamza will have its own image”, Berisha confirmed.

The head of the government promised to open schools and kindergartens, which will have same standards with the Eueropean ones.

“We will build 23 schools and kindergartens. Five big schools are under construction. Your schools will be completely European”, Berisha added.
